Elevated Parkbuilding 101

“We did have to ultimately remove all of the existing landscape that was up there to go down to the bare structure. We waterproof it, redo the drainage system. Actually, the single most expensive part of the project was repainting the structure. It had originally been painted in lead paint. So, it had to be put in containment units and all sandblasted, primed, and repainted. It was the single biggest part of the job.”

-on the High Line
